I've been trying several mics to find my VO/Podcast business. My voice is raspy, think Clint Eastwood, Peter Coyote, etc... Certain mics can't work for me. I returned the Rode NT1-A, EV RE20, but kept the Shure sm7b and EV RE27. I have to use the high pass filter. So I can't tell you what's great for you, you have to try them and see which works for you. All of those a great mics, I chose the ones that worked for me.
